<p>I was idling in #coldfusion on Dalnet this morning and amongst the distorted, haphazard conversations that usually occur in there, an awesome little tidbit of code popped up. Courtesy of <a href="http://www.alagad.com/blog/author.cfm/Chris-Peterson" target="_blank">Chris Peterson of Alagad</a> fame.</p>
<p>Someone was asking about the formatting of the code that &lt;CFDUMP&gt; spits out and Chris suggested a few scenarios, one of which he said he uses all the time:</p>
<p style="text-align: center;"><strong>&lt;cfdump format=&#8221;html&#8221; output=&#8221;c:\#createUUID()#_dump.html&#8221; var=&#8221;#whatever#&#8221; /&gt;</strong></p>
<p>That tasty morsel spits the output to a handy dandy .html file. All these years, I&#8217;m ashamed to say I never knew you could do that. Very awesome. Thanks Chris.
